| Resumen | A predatory, motile, Gram-negative bacterium, 22V T , was isolated from a soil sample collected from Tamaulipas, Mexico, which forms plaques on Vibrio parahaemolyticus prey. It was identified as a member of the genus Bdellovibrio based on its 16S rRNA gene sequence. It has a circular genome of 3,601,631 bp with 3,437 protein-coding genes, one rRNA gene cluster and a G+C (mol%) content of 46.7 mol%. Phylogenetic analysis based on the 16S rRNA gene, concatenated housekeeping genes and core genes placed 22V T as a member of a new species. The digital DNA–DNA hybridization, average nucleotide identity and average amino acid identity values of <21%, <80% and <78%, respectively, between 22V T and other known species in the genus Bdellovibrio are below the threshold for species delineation. 22V T can prey on Gram-negative bacteria, including nine strains from seven genera ( Escherichia, Klebsiella , Proteus , Pseudomonas, Salmonella , Shigella and Vibrio ). By fluorescence and cryo-electron microscopy, 22V T was observed as a tiny, motile bacterium that invaded the periplasmic space of host cells to form bdelloplasts, supporting a periplasmic predatory lifestyle. The unique rRNA gene cluster was located on a genomic island near an incomplete prophage. The rRNA gene yielded a phylogeny that conflicts with the phylogeny based on the core genes or housekeeping genes, suggesting that this rRNA gene cluster was obtained by horizontal transfer. Based on the phenotypic and phylogenomic results, 22V T represents a novel species in the genus Bdellovibrio , for which Bdellovibrio bacteriopascens sp. nov. is proposed. The type strain is 22V T (=ATCC TSD- 365 T =CM-CNRG 933 T ). | es_ES |
